• Title/Summary/Keyword: Processing element

Search Result 1,750, Processing Time 0.029 seconds

Design of VLSI Architecture for Efficient Exponentiation on $GF(2^m)$ ($GF(2^m)$ 상에서의 효율적인 지수제곱 연산을 위한 VLSI Architecture 설계)

  • 한영모
    • Journal of the Institute of Electronics Engineers of Korea SC
    • /
    • v.41 no.6
    • /
    • pp.27-35
    • /
    • 2004
  • Finite or Galois fields have been used in numerous applications such as error correcting codes, digital signal processing and cryptography. These applications often require exponetiation on GF(2$^{m}$ ) which is a very computationally intensive operation. Most of the existing methods implemented the exponetiation by iterative methods using repeated multiplications, which leads to much computational load, or needed much hardware cost because of their structural complexity in implementing. In this paper, we present an effective VLSI architecture for exponentiation on GF(2$^{m}$ ). This circuit computes the exponentiation by multiplying product terms, each of which corresponds to an exponent bit. Until now use of this type algorithm has been confined to a primitive element but we generalize it to any elements in GF(2$^{m}$ ).

A Novel Spiral-Type Motion Estimation Architecture for H.264/AVC

  • Hirai, Naoyuki;Song, Tian;Liu, Yizhong;Shimamoto, Takashi
    • JSTS:Journal of Semiconductor Technology and Science
    • /
    • v.10 no.1
    • /
    • pp.37-44
    • /
    • 2010
  • New features of motion compensation, such as variable block size and multiple reference frames are introduced in H.264/AVC. However, these new features induce significant implementation complexity increases. In this paper, an efficient architecture for spiral-type motion estimation is proposed. First, we propose a hardware-friendly spiral search order. Then, an efficient processing element (PE) architecture for ME is proposed to achieve the proposed search order. The improved PE enables one-pixel-move of the reference pixel data to top, bottom, right, and left by four ports for input and output. Moreover, the parallel calculation architecture to calculate all block size with the SAD of 4x4 is introduced in the proposed architecture. As the result of hardware implementation, the hardware cost is about 145k gates. Maximum clock frequency is 134 MHz in the case of FPGA (Xilinx Vertex5) implementation.

Design and Implementation of IDAO for Efficient Access of Database in EJB Based Application (EJB 기반 애플리케이션에서 데이터베이스의 효율적 액세스를 위한 IDAO의 설계 및 구현)

  • Choe, Seong-Man;Lee, Jeong-Yeol;Yu, Cheol-Jung;Jang, Ok-Bae
    • The KIPS Transactions:PartD
    • /
    • v.8D no.6
    • /
    • pp.637-644
    • /
    • 2001
  • EJB, providing specification for development and deployment of component based application, permits distributed development as central element of J2EE environment that manages automatically transaction management, persistence, concurrency control that are the most complicated work in enterprise environment. In this paper, we wish to resolve DAO's transaction logic complexity and performance reduction of system in the EJB based legacy system. Therefore, this paper describes the design and implementation of IDAO that applies Iterator pattern. IDAO gets effect that reduces complexity of transaction logic, system overload by database connection, and reduction of performance through container managed transaction.

  • PDF

Generating Test Cases for Object-Oriented Design Specification (OCL로 기술된 객체지향 설계 명세의 테스트 케이스 생성)

  • Choe, Eun-Man
    • The KIPS Transactions:PartD
    • /
    • v.8D no.6
    • /
    • pp.843-852
    • /
    • 2001
  • Statistics concerning software errors indicate that more errors are introduced in analysis and design phase than implementation phase. Therefore, it is needed to check whether the design modeling is appropriate for own function and structure. This paper discussed the effective test method for the object-oriented design model, i.e., UML. A new method was proposed for generating test data. This method consists of category partition theory by the representation each element in UML model with OCL (Object Constraint Language). Test data generated in this way can be used for testing the source code functionality as well as for checking the design model.

  • PDF

Synthesis of highly crystalline nanoporous titanium dioxide at room temperature (상온에서 고결정성 나노기공 이산화티탄 제조기술)

  • Chung, Pyung Jin;Kwon, Yong Seok
    • Journal of Energy Engineering
    • /
    • v.25 no.2
    • /
    • pp.65-78
    • /
    • 2016
  • Initial studies of the photocatalyst has been developed from the field relating to the conversion and storage of solar energy. Recently, the study of the various organic decomposition compound and the water purification and waste water treatment by ultraviolet irradiation in the presence of light or a photocatalyst are being actively investigated. In addition, the oxidized material-carbon nanotubes, graphene-nanocomposites have been studied. Such a complex is suitable as a material constituting the solar cells and photolysis nanoelectronics, including the flexible element due to thermal and chemical stability.

A Study on Edge Detection Algorithm in Salt & Pepper Noise Environments (Salt & Pepper 잡음 환경에서 에지 검출 알고리즘에 관한 연구)

  • Lee, Chang-Young;Kim, Nam-Ho
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.18 no.8
    • /
    • pp.1973-1980
    • /
    • 2014
  • Edge detection for such as image, lane and object recognition is important image processing method. And some traditional method for this, there are Sobel, Prewitt, Roberts, Laplacian, LoG(Laplacian of Gaussian) and so on. Characteristics of these methods are insufficient in the salt & pepper noise added image. In order to improve such a problem of conventional methods, in this paper, we proposed an algorithm applying the weighted mask for detecting an edge by setting the local mask centered on the adjacent of the central pixel if central pixel of the mask is non-noise, it is intactly set by element of estimated mask, after calculating estimated mask if it is noise.

Development of Technical Reference Model and Standard Profile Management System (기술참조모델과 표준프로파일 관리 시스템 개발)

  • Choi, Nam-Yong;Song, Young-Jae
    • The KIPS Transactions:PartD
    • /
    • v.12D no.5 s.101
    • /
    • pp.729-736
    • /
    • 2005
  • MND(Ministry of National Defense) has developed MND AF(Ministry of National Defense Architecture Framework) and CADM(Core Architecture Data Model) to guarantee interoperability among defense information systems. TRM(Technical Reference Model) and SP(Standard Profile) product defined in MND AF is core part of Information Technology Architecture and core element of interoperability guarantee. In this paper, we proposed a method which manages technical service and standard of TRM and SP, and developed TRM and SP management system based on the method. TRM and SP management system provides the basis for interoperability among information systems and a more efficient development and management of TRM and SP product.

Design and Implementation of an HTML Pages Modification Detector for Meta-search Engines (메타 검색엔진을 위한 HTML 문서 변경 탐지기의 설계 및 구현)

  • Park, Sang-Wi;O, Jeong-Seok;Lee, Sang-Ho
    • The KIPS Transactions:PartD
    • /
    • v.9D no.3
    • /
    • pp.345-354
    • /
    • 2002
  • HTML pages in the web change at any time. It could cause to decrease the functionality of meta-search engines which provide users with integrated results of search engines. To solve this problem, we propose an HTML pages modification detector. It utilities information of element positions in HTML pages and the modified Jaak Vilo algorithm. The HTML page modification detector uses patterns that represent the structure of HTML expressions occurring repeatedly in HTML pages. An experiment is carried out to verify the correctness of the modification detector.

Broadband polarimetric Microstrip Antennas for Space-borne SAR

  • Hong, Lei;Qunying, Zhang;Guang, Fu
    • Proceedings of the KSRS Conference
    • /
    • 2002.10a
    • /
    • pp.465-470
    • /
    • 2002
  • A novel phased array antenna system for space-borne polarimetric SAR is proposed and completed in this paper.The antenna system assures polarimetric and multi-mode capability of SAR. It has broadband, high polarization isolation and high port to port isolation. The antenna system is composed of broadband polarimetric microstrip antenna, T/R modules and multifunction beam controller nit. The polarimetric microstrip antenna has more than 100MHz bandwidth at L-band with -30dB polarization isolation and high port to port isolation. The microstrip element and T/R module's structure and characteristics, the subarray's performances measuring results are presented in detail in this paper. A design scheme on beam controller of the phased array antenna is also proposed and completed, which is based on Digital Signal Processing (DSP) chip -TMS320F206. This beam controller unit has small size and high reliability compared with general beam controller. In addition, the multifunction beam controller unit can acquire and then send the T/R module's working states to detection system in real time.

  • PDF

Study of Stress Distribution of Cold Rolled Steel Sheets in Tension Leveling Process (냉연 형상 교정시 Stress 천이 현상 연구)

  • Choi H. T.;Hwang S. M.;Koo J. M.;Park K. C.
    • Transactions of Materials Processing
    • /
    • v.13 no.6 s.70
    • /
    • pp.497-502
    • /
    • 2004
  • The shape of cold rolled steel sheets is defined as the degree of flatness, and the flatter, the better. Because undesirable strip shapes of cold rolled steel sheets can affect not only visible problem but also automatic working process in customer's lines, the requirement of the customers is more and more stringent. So we usually used the tension leveler to make high quality of strip flatness. For the improvement of the quality of strip flatness, this report developed three- dimensional FEM (Finite Element Method) simulation model, and analysis about the strain and stress distribution of strip in the tension leveling process. The numerical study can be summarized as follows. (1) If we pass the edge wave material (steepness: $1.0\%$) that the stress-difference between the strip center and the edge is 5.2kgf through tension leveler. the stress-difference is decreased 0.45kgf and the steepness is improved to $0.29\%$. (2) If the Intermesh is increased from 6mm to 7mm, the steepness is improved from $0.294\%$ to $0.268\%$. (3) If the initial steepness is decreased form $1.0\%$ to $0.75\%$, the final steepness is improved from $0.294\%$ to $0.263\%$. We know that more increased intermesh and lower initial steepness make the final steepness improved.